What are the only two ares of the human body where friction ridge skin is found?
Palmer surface of the hand
Plantar surface of the foot
Human friction ridges have been found through research and practical application to be suitable for scientific identification through which two basic factors?
Individual- no two people have the same fingerprints, palm prints or bare foot prints
Permanent- pattern details of friction ridge skin are permanent.
The fingerprint is typically defined as the recording of the friction ridge details of the bulb of the finger from ….
Nail edge to nail edge and from fingertip to the crease of the first lower joint.
What is the Automated Fingerprint Identification System (AFIS)?
Searchable databases of known and unknown fingerprints.
What is IAFIS?
Its the FBI database that manages over 63 million criminal fingerprints records nationally with approx. 13,000 new records daily.

What is R-84 form? (Final Disposition Report)
It is used by the FBI Criminal Justice Information Services (CJIS) to report initial arrest data and thereafter secure the final disposition of the charges.
What side of the R-84 is completed by the arresting agency?
The left side, should match the data on the OG fingerprint card.
Standard major case print card collection consists of a minimum of how many cards?
5 cards minimum
- FBI standard Fingerprint Card (ten-print card)
- Standard palm print card (FD-844) one per hand
- FBI standard supplement finger and palm print card (FD-884a) one card per hand
What card requires 5 impressions for each finger/thumb?
FD-884a
For a palm recording on a FD-844 the card is wrapped around what type of object?
Cylindrical object of at least 3 inches in diameter.
